Key Features to Look For

When you shop for a coffee maker with a water line, keep these important features in mind:

Brewing Capacity

  • Single Serve vs. Full Pot: Do you usually make just one cup, or are you brewing for a crowd? Machines come in various sizes.
  • Carafe Material: Glass carafes are common and let you see how much coffee is left. Thermal carafes keep coffee hot longer without a warming plate, which can scorch coffee.

Water Filtration

  • Built-in Filter: Some machines have a water filter that removes impurities. This makes your coffee taste better and helps keep the machine clean.
  • Filter Type: Look for machines that use standard charcoal filters or offer other filtration options.

Programmability and Convenience

  • Programmable Timer: Set your coffee to brew at a specific time. Wake up to the smell of fresh coffee!
  • Auto Shut-Off: This safety feature turns off the machine after a set period.
  • Brew Pause: Need a cup before the pot is done? This lets you grab one without making a mess.
  • Adjustable Brew Strength: Some machines let you choose how strong you want your coffee.

Ease of Use and Cleaning

  • Simple Controls: Look for intuitive buttons and clear displays.
  • Removable Parts: Parts like the brew basket and carafe should be easy to remove for cleaning.
  • Self-Cleaning Function: Some machines have a self-cleaning cycle, which is a big time-saver.

Important Materials

The materials used in your coffee maker affect its durability and how your coffee tastes.

  • Stainless Steel: Many higher-end machines use stainless steel for their bodies and carafes. This is durable and looks sleek.
  • BPA-Free Plastics: Most plastic parts, like the water reservoir and brew basket, should be made from BPA-free plastic. This is safer for your health.
  • Glass: Glass carafes are common. They are easy to clean but can break if dropped.
  • Heating Element: Most machines use a metal heating element. Stainless steel is generally more durable than aluminum.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Several things can make a coffee maker great or not so great.

What Makes a Coffee Maker Better?

  • Consistent Brewing Temperature: The ideal temperature for brewing coffee is between 195°F and 205°F. Machines that maintain this temperature make better-tasting coffee.
  • Even Water Distribution: The machine should evenly saturate the coffee grounds. This ensures all the flavor is extracted.
  • Good Build Quality: A sturdy machine that feels solid will last longer.
  • Effective Filtration: A good water filter makes a noticeable difference in taste.

What Can Make a Coffee Maker Worse?

  • Cheap Plastic Parts: These can crack or warp over time. They might also affect the taste of your coffee.
  • Inconsistent Heating: If the water isn’t hot enough, your coffee will taste weak.
  • Poor Water Flow: If water doesn’t flow through the grounds evenly, you won’t get the best flavor.
  • Difficult to Clean: A machine that is hard to clean can lead to mold and bad-tasting coffee.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What is the main benefit of a coffee maker with a water line?

A: The main benefit is that you don’t have to manually fill the water tank. It connects directly to your water supply, so you always have water ready for brewing.

Q: How do I connect the water line to the coffee maker?

A: Most machines come with a connection kit and instructions. You typically connect a hose from your water supply to the back of the coffee maker. Some might require a plumber if you’re not comfortable doing it yourself.

Q: Can I use any coffee maker with a water line hookup?

A: No, only coffee makers specifically designed with a water line input can be connected. You cannot adapt a regular coffee maker to use a water line.

Q: Do I need a special water filter for these machines?

A: Many machines come with a filter or recommend a specific type. Using a water filter improves the taste of your coffee and keeps the machine cleaner.

Q: How much does it cost to install a water line connection for a coffee maker?

A: The cost varies depending on your location and if you hire a plumber. For a simple hookup, it might cost around $100-$300 if you need professional help.

Q: What if my water pressure is too high?

A: Some coffee makers come with a pressure regulator, or you might need to install one. This protects the machine from damage.

Q: Are these coffee makers hard to clean?

A: Generally, they are designed for convenience. Removable parts make cleaning easier. Some models have a self-cleaning feature.

Q: Can I turn off the water line when I’m not using the coffee maker?

A: Yes, you can usually turn off the water supply valve when the machine is not in use, especially if you’re going away for an extended period.

Q: Do these coffee makers take up more counter space?

A: They might be slightly larger due to the internal plumbing, but they still fit on most standard countertops. Check the dimensions before buying.
